Europe Specialty Catheters Market Outlook 2024–2033 Growth, Trends & Forecast Analysis

The Europe Specialty Catheters Market is experiencing robust growth as healthcare systems across the region increasingly adopt advanced minimally invasive diagnostic and therapeutic procedures. Specialty catheters are widely used in cardiology, neurovascular, urology, and interventional radiology applications, enabling precise access to complex anatomical regions with improved safety and efficiency. Rising prevalence of chronic diseases and strong emphasis on early diagnosis and effective treatment are key factors driving market expansion across Europe.

From a market perspective, the Europe Specialty Catheters Market size is expected to reach US$ 3,078.5 million by 2033 from US$ 1,329.2 million in 2024, reflecting substantial expansion in interventional healthcare adoption and medical device utilization. The market is estimated to register a CAGR of 10.1% from 2025 to 2033, indicating strong growth driven by increasing demand for minimally invasive procedures, rising healthcare expenditure, and continuous advancements in catheter-based technologies across European healthcare systems.

The key Europe Specialty Catheters Market Growth Drivers include the increasing prevalence of cardiovascular diseases, neurological disorders, and urological conditions. Aging populations across Europe, combined with lifestyle-related risk factors such as obesity, diabetes, and hypertension, are significantly contributing to higher disease burden. Additionally, strong healthcare infrastructure and widespread access to advanced diagnostic and treatment facilities are supporting higher adoption of specialty catheter-based procedures.

Another major driver is continuous technological advancement in catheter design and interventional techniques. Innovations such as hydrophilic-coated catheters, steerable and torque-responsive designs, and improved flexibility are enhancing procedural accuracy and reducing complication risks. The increasing use of imaging-guided interventions, including fluoroscopy and intravascular ultrasound, is also improving clinical outcomes and expanding the scope of catheter-based treatments.

The Europe Specialty Catheters Market Trends highlight a strong shift toward safer, more efficient, and patient-friendly interventional solutions. One key trend is the growing adoption of single-use and disposable catheters to reduce infection risks and improve procedural safety. Another trend is the integration of catheter-based procedures with advanced imaging and navigation systems for improved precision. Additionally, increasing use of AI-assisted planning tools is gradually optimizing interventional procedures in leading European hospitals.

The market is also benefiting from a rising focus on outpatient and minimally invasive procedures. Healthcare providers are increasingly shifting toward treatments that reduce hospital stays, lower healthcare costs, and improve patient recovery times. Furthermore, increasing collaboration between medical device manufacturers, research institutions, and healthcare providers is accelerating innovation and expanding product availability across the region.

The market presents strong Europe Specialty Catheters Market Opportunities, particularly in expanding applications across interventional cardiology, neurovascular procedures, and electrophysiology. Countries such as Germany, France, the United Kingdom, Italy, and Spain are leading adoption due to strong healthcare infrastructure and high procedural volumes. Meanwhile, Eastern European markets are gradually emerging as high-growth areas due to ongoing healthcare modernization.

Despite strong growth prospects, the market faces challenges such as high costs of advanced catheter systems, strict regulatory requirements, and reimbursement variability across different countries. Additionally, limited access to highly specialized interventional procedures in certain regions may restrict uniform adoption. However, ongoing innovation and healthcare investment are expected to gradually overcome these barriers.

Looking ahead, the Europe Specialty Catheters Market Future Outlook remains highly positive, supported by rising chronic disease burden, continuous technological innovation, and increasing adoption of minimally invasive procedures. As Europe continues to advance its interventional healthcare capabilities, specialty catheters are expected to play an increasingly critical role in modern medical treatment through 2033 and beyond.
